A new two-party coalition government was sworn in Tuesday in Estonia, led by the first woman prime minister since the Baltic nation regained independence in 1991. The 15-member Cabinet of Prime Minister Kaja Kallas took office after lawmakers in Estonia’s parliament approved the government appointed by President Kersti Kaljulaid. Kallas, 43, is a lawyer and former European Parliament member. The center-right Reform Party that she chairs and and the left-leaning Center Party, which are Estonia’s two biggest political parties, reached a deal on Sunday to form a government. The previous Cabinet, with Center leader Juri Ratas as prime minister, collapsed this month due to a corruption scandal.

Kantar Emor: Estonia 200 keeps second place in Emor ratings

The non-parliamentary Estonia 200 party secured a rating of 18 percent in pollster Kantar Emor s monthly poll in December, good enough to keep its second place in front of the Conservative People s Party (EKRE) and Center Party. The opposition Reform Party remains on top, while its rating has come down from 33 percent in October to 28 percent in November and 27 percent in December. Estonia 200 rose to second place in November and maintained the position and its rating of 18 percent in December on 18 percent. EKRE (17 percent) took third place from Prime Minister Jüri Ratas Center Party that landed in fourth on 16 percent in December.
